The GRE, or Graduate Record Examination, is a standardized test once widely required for graduate admissions, measuring verbal, quantitative, and analytical skills. Many universities are now waiving it, recognizing that academic performance, writing samples, and professional experience provide more accurate reflections of readiness. Waivers also improve accessibility by reducing financial and testing barriers, encouraging broader participation while still maintaining rigorous academic evaluation through other admission materials.

| Scholarship | Lambda Iota Tau Literature Scholarships |
| Description | The Lambda Iota Tau Literature Scholarships are offered through the American national honor society for literature, founded in 1953 at Michigan State University. Eligible students must demonstrate strong academic achievement in literature studies. Beyond financial support, the scholarships foster professional growth, networking, publication opportunities, and participation in enriching literary and community projects. |
| Award/Amount | $5000 |
| Application Deadline | Varies |
| Scholarship | William C. Johnson Distinguished Scholarship |
| Description | The William C. Johnson Distinguished Scholarship honors academic excellence and service within Sigma Tau Delta at multiple levels. Applicants must demonstrate strong scholarship, leadership, and a commitment to fostering the discipline of English, including literature, language, writing, and literacy. Selection emphasizes academic achievement, community engagement, and submission of a polished critical essay that demonstrates depth, originality, and disciplinary relevance. |
| Award/Amount | $6000 |
| Application Deadline | Varies |

Accreditation ensures that online programs meet rigorous academic and institutional standards, offering credibility and quality assurance for students. For literature programs, accreditation by organizations such as the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C) or similar regional accrediting bodies validates academic excellence. Accreditation benefits students by ensuring transferability of credits, eligibility for federal financial aid, and enhanced career opportunities. Employers and doctoral programs often prefer graduates from accredited institutions, as this reinforces the long-term value of their degrees.
